3 out of 5 stars It's rather pleasant and fun but not outstanding.......2003-10-03

This album is a collection of covers, guest appearances and left over material. I have the opinion that most of the time (but not always) the original version of a song is the better one, and that the value of a cover can be highly questionable. My curiosity made me buy this album and I quite like it. Some of the covers are rather unexpected like Scorpions "He's a woman, she's a man", Alice Cooper's "Billion dollar babies" and Ozzy Osbourne's "Flying high", but to hear another version of "Rolling and tumbling" is just boring to say the least. If you're a big fan of George Lynch I believe you consider this a must have, but others (more casual fans) might not think this album is essential. Anyway, it's rather fun and enjoyable to hear these songs, but aren't the original versions better?

One more thing: I wish there were more information regarding the songs, personal (i. e. singers) and where the songs appear in the first place.

3 out of 5 stars A collection of George Lynch Oddities.......2005-08-24

This is a collection of rare tracks, many cover-tunes in the vein of his "Curious George" album. Standout tracks include Mr. Crowley, Rollin And Tumblin, and Train Keeps A Rollin'. There a few left-over Lynch Mob tracks, but they are among the album's weakest songs (there was a reason they were left off the original Lynch Mob albums). Kudos to George for tackling a variety of classic rock tracks, some with more success than others. The variety of the types of tracks on the album make it a relatively discontinous listen but there are some gems. The soloing on Mr. Crowley is a particular standout and it is almost worth buying the whole album just for that track.

      Album Description

      This CD features tracks from tributes, guest appearances, B-sides, and an unreleased song. 16 tracks total and George gives a brief recollection of the events for each track in the sleeve notes. Rock Empire. 2001.
